Conguring Junos OS on the EX4600
Before you begin connecng and conguring an EX4600 switch, set the following parameter values on
the console server or PC:
Baud Rate—9600
Flow Control—None
Data—8
Parity—None
Stop Bits—1
DCD State—Disregard
You must perform the inial conguraon of the EX4600 switch through the console port using the
command-line interface (CLI).
To connect and congure the switch from the console:
1. Connect the console port to a laptop or PC using the supplied RJ-45 cable and RJ-45 to DB-9
adapter. The console (CON) port is located on the management panel of the switch.
2. Log in as root. There is no password. If the soware booted before you connected to the console
port, you might need to press the Enter key for the prompt to appear.
login: root
3. Start the CLI.
root@% cli
4. Enter conguraon mode.
root> configure
5. Add a password to the root administraon user account.
[edit]
root@# set system root-authentication plain-text-password
